E-Session: Ashley & Aaron
Honeymoon Island, Dunedin | Dunedin Engagement Photos

Within minutes of our arriving at Ashley and Aaron’s engagement session on Honeymoon Island, the sky turned black. We had only a handful of photos at that point, and when it started pouring, we decided to wait it out in our cars, and to try again if it stopped. Needless to say, we went through this drill about two or three times, but the resulting sunset was phenomenal and worth that wait. Congrats to Ashley and Aaron, you guys did great! Looking forward to the wedding day!
